Designed Around High-Cycle Regional Operations
Saab reports fatigue testing on a static Saab 340 aircraft
exceeded 200,000 cycles, representing decades of typical
regional-aircraft operations.
Saab also states that metal bonding is used extensively
throughout the aircraft structure.

Supporting Saab 340 Aircraft Through Continued Service
Production of the Saab 340 ended in 1999, but Saab continues
to support the fleet and reports substantial remaining
structural life in many aircraft.
Mature regional aircraft can still require structural
inspections, corrosion repair, review of previous repairs,
aging wiring work and avionics modernization.
